Follow-up on top of mvanhorn's cherry-picked commit. Original PR only wired request_timeout_seconds into the explicit-creds OpenAI branch at run_agent.py init; router-based implicit auth, native Anthropic, and the fallback chain were still hardcoded to SDK defaults. - agent/anthropic_adapter.py: build_anthropic_client() accepts an optional timeout kwarg (default 900s preserved when unset/invalid). - run_agent.py: resolve per-provider/per-model timeout once at init; apply to Anthropic native init + post-refresh rebuild + stale/interrupt rebuilds + switch_model + _restore_primary_runtime + the OpenAI implicit-auth path + _try_activate_fallback (with immediate client rebuild so the first fallback request carries the configured timeout). - tests: cover anthropic adapter kwarg honoring; widen mock signatures to accept the new timeout kwarg. - docs/example: clarify that the knob now applies to every transport, the fallback chain, and rebuilds after credential rotation. |
